2002-2003 Division I Men Pairwise Rankings (PWR)
Rk Team                GP  W- L- T  Win%  Rk     RPI  Rk  PWR
 1 Colorado College    32 23- 4- 5 0.7969  2 | 0.6021  1 | 28
 2 Maine               34 23- 6- 5 0.7500  3 | 0.5951  2 | 27
 3 Cornell             27 22- 4- 1 0.8333  1 | 0.5946  3 | 26
 4 Boston College      32 21- 8- 3 0.7031  7 | 0.5874  4 | 24
   New Hampshire       32 20- 7- 5 0.7031  7 | 0.5812  6 | 24
 6 Ferris State        32 23- 8- 1 0.7344  4 | 0.5724  8 | 22
 7 Boston University   34 20-11- 3 0.6324 15 | 0.5767  7 | 21
 8 Minnesota           33 18- 8- 7 0.6515 12 | 0.5863  5 | 20
   St. Cloud State     30 14-12- 4 0.5333 24 | 0.5695  9 | 20
10 Michigan            32 23- 8- 1 0.7344  4 | 0.5627 11 | 19
11 North Dakota        34 22- 8- 4 0.7059  6 | 0.5688 10 | 18
   MSU-Mankato         32 16- 7- 9 0.6406 13 | 0.5562 13 | 18
13 Ohio State          33 21- 9- 3 0.6818 10 | 0.5508 16 | 16
14 Denver              34 20- 9- 5 0.6618 11 | 0.5577 12 | 15
   Providence          33 18-12- 3 0.5909 19 | 0.5535 14 | 15
16 Harvard             27 18- 8- 1 0.6852  9 | 0.5532 15 | 12
   Michigan State      32 18-12- 2 0.5938 18 | 0.5302 18 | 12
18 Merrimack           31 12-14- 5 0.4677 36 | 0.5352 17 |  9
   Miami               34 18-14- 2 0.5588 23 | 0.5212 20 |  9
   Dartmouth           27 15-11- 1 0.5741 20 | 0.5187 24 |  9
   Northern Michigan   32 16-14- 2 0.5312 25 | 0.5181 25 |  9
22 Western Michigan    32 14-16- 2 0.4688 32 | 0.5292 19 |  7
   Massachusetts       33 16-16- 1 0.5000 27 | 0.5199 22 |  7
24 Notre Dame          32 13-13- 6 0.5000 27 | 0.5204 21 |  6
25 Yale                27 17-10- 0 0.6296 16 | 0.5198 23 |  5
   Minnesota-Duluth    32 16-12- 4 0.5625 22 | 0.5138 26 |  5
27 Mass.-Lowell        31 10-17- 4 0.3871 45 | 0.5121 27 |  2
28 Alaska-Fairbanks    30 12-12- 6 0.5000 27 | 0.5060 28 |  1
29 Alabama-Huntsville  30 17-10- 3 0.6167 17 | 0.5059 29 |  0

The Pairwise Ranking is a system which attempts to mimic the method
used by the NCAA Selection Committee to determine participants for the
NCAA Division I men's hockey tournament. The PWR compares teams with a
Ratings Percentage Index (RPI) at or above .500, judging them by four
criteria: record against common opponents, head to head competition,
record against other teams with RPIs at or above .500, and the RPI.

For each comparison won, a team receives one point. The final PWR
ranking is based on the number of points (comparisons) won against
teams at or above .500. Ties are settled by the RPI.

Note: A team's record is based only on games against other Division I
hockey schools which are eligible for the NCAA Tournament. In
particular, only non-exhibition matchups between schools in the six
major conferences count towards a team's record as used in the RPI and
PWR. Other games, including contests against Canadian schools and
tournament-ineligible D-I programs, are not counted.
